Australian singer Max Sharam: Where is she now?

Max Sharam first appeared on our TV screens in the 90s and then our radio waves with her hit songs like Coma. Then she disappeared. This is her new life.

Max Sharam was just 23 when she appeared on the talent show New Faces in 1992, performing her song Coma, which would catapult her into Australian stardom.

However, she told News Corp Australia in New York that she originally auditioned with a stand-up routine she had been performing around Sydney.

“I was doing a comedy country and western character who only wore gold lame,” Sharam says. “They told me ‘we want you on the show, do you have anything of your own?’ So I had Coma, which I had already written and which I was a little embarrassed by because it was so weird and such a private song.”

“It was winter, it was July, and it felt like everyone in Australia just happened to be home watching TV that night and here is this chick in a gold lame outfit singing a weird song,” she says.

The record companies came knocking at her door but Sharam says it was two years before her album A Million Year Girl would be released by Warner Music.

“Had they signed me and released me within six months I feel like it would have taken off even more than it did,” Sharam says. “They should have let me out of the barriers and I would have galloped down the straight. I am a racehorse. I would have won the race but instead they kept me in the stables for way too long and I feel like we missed the moment. I was chomping at the bit.”

Coma still reached No. 14 on the ARIA singles chart and was voted the 8th most popular song in Triple J’s Hottest 100 of 1994. A Million Year Girl provided two more Top 40 singles, Be Firm (No. 25) and Lay Down (No. 36), with the album, released in 1995, reaching gold status and peaking at No. 9 on the Australian charts.

She was nominated for eight ARIA Awards, losing out in most categories to Tina Arena and Silverchair, but picking up an award for Best Cover Art.

Sharam went to Los Angeles to record her second album but split with Warner due to creative differences.

“I wanted to make a heavier second album. I wanted to do something where you would sit down and listen to it and be unable to get up,” she says. “I wanted to work with (Canadian producer) Daniel Lanois who did For the Beauty of Wynona but Warner didn’t want to spend the money on me.”

“Perhaps moving to LA worked against me because I was perceived to have abandoned ship. I was seen as a turncoat,” she says.

Sharam largely disappeared from Australian eyes. She self-published a book called Snakes Live Under My Bed, appeared in the TV documentary show Dream Factory, and performed in the Melbourne International Comedy festival in 2000 and 2009.

She also supported Cyndi Lauper on her She’s So Unusual 30th Anniversary Tour in 2014.

Now firmly ensconced in New York City, Sharam tells News Corp Australia that she doesn’t want to contain herself to one art-form.

“I am definitely an interdisciplinary artist. I would love my own Broadway show. It would be a hybrid sort of Elaine Stritch-style show with music and comedy,” she says. “The running joke now is that Tim Minchin stole my career because essentially that is what I started out doing.”

Sharam says she “doesn’t subscribe to the idea of age” but her Wikipedia page says she has just turned 50.

Asked if she has any regrets, Sharam says “I was never going to be a conventional recording artist.”

“I didn’t know how to play the game and the music industry didn’t really understand how to develop new talent,” she says. “The magic is there on A Million Year Girl but when I look back and feel disappointed by it to be honest. I feel like it should have been bigger but they wanted to box me in to this Indie market rather than making it a bigger commercial success.”

Sharam, who still owns an apartment in Sydney that she rents out, says her best advice would be for women to be financially independent.

“Girls should buy their own piece of real estate because every woman needs their own home. Do not marry for money, be independent. Why are so many women waiting for men to liberate them? Get financially independent girls, buy your own property, and then you will be able to do what you want,” she says.
